HC to hear NSE-SGX case on May 26
NSE’s Index company on Monday had filed a petition before the Bombay High Court against the SGX.

The Bombay High Court will continue to hear the NSE's petition against SGX launching new derivatives product.
NSE’s Index company on Monday had filed a petition before the Bombay High Court against the SGX seeking interim reliefs against the marketing, promotion and launch of three new contracts — SGX India Futures, SGX Options on SGX India Futures and SGX India Bank Futures, in terms of its circular dated April 11, 2018.
“Until then, the ad-interim injunction granted on May 21, 2018 continues against the launch of new derivative contracts by SGX..,” said NSE.
